Unfortunately, Shopify does not currently offer a built-in feature to print barcodes directly from Purchase Orders (POs). However, here are two straightforward solutions:

1-Use Shopify's Retail Barcode Labels App (Free):

  • Install the app from the Shopify App Store.
  • Manually add products to your inventory after receiving the PO and then generate and print barcodes.

2-Third-Party Apps (Paid Options):

  • Apps like Stocky (for Shopify POS Pro) or others may help streamline the process. These can integrate with purchase orders but typically come with additional costs.

You can also submit feedback directly to Shopify through Settings > Feedback to request this feature.
